The development team working on Splinter Cell: Blacklist is delivering a new version of the system requirements linked to the game, which differs from the list that was posted via Steam when it comes to the clock of the processor.

The system requirements are on the official forums:

Minimum

Windows XP with SP3 or Windows Vista with SP2 or Windows 7 with SP1) or Windows 8 2.13 GHz Intel Core2 Duo E6400 or 2.80 GHz AMD Athlon 64 X2 5600+ processor or better 2 GB of RAM 512 MB DirectX 10 capable graphics card using Shader Model 4.0 or better DirectX 9 25 GB of free hard drive space Supported: Windows compatible keyboard, mouse, headset, optional controller

Recommended

Windows XP with SP3 or Windows Vista with SP2 or Windows 7 with SP1) or Windows 8 2.66 GHz Intel Core2 Quad Q8400 or 3.00 GHz AMD Phenom II X4 940 or better 4 GB of RAM DirectX 11 25 GB of free hard drive space Broadband Internet connection Supported: Windows compatible keyboard, mouse, headset, optional controller

The new game focuses on Sam Fisher as he takes control of a new Fourth Echelon and battles a new terrorist threat.

The title will be out on August 20 in North America and three days later in Europe on the PC and home consoles.
